This book provides readers with a comprehensive review of the state
of the art in error control for Network on Chip (NOC) links.
Coverage includes detailed description of key issues in NOC error
control faced by circuit and system designers, as well as practical
error control techniques to minimize the impact of these errors on
system performance.
This book provides a range of application areas of data and
knowledge management and their solutions for the fields related to
the convergence of information and communication technology (ICT),
healthcare, and telecommunication services. The authors present
approaches and case studies in future technological trends and
challenges in the aforementioned fields. The book acts as a
scholarly forum for researchers both in academia and industry.

The two volume set LNCS 12506 and 12507 constitutes the proceedings
of the 19th International Semantic Web Conference, ISWC 2020, which
was planned to take place in Athens, Greece, during November 2-6,
2020. The conference changed to a virtual format due to the
COVID-19 pandemic. The papers included in this volume deal with the
latest advances in fundamental research, innovative technology, and
applications of the Semantic Web, linked data, knowledge graphs,
and knowledge processing on the Web. They were carefully reviewed
and selected for inclusion in the proceedings as follows: Part I:
Features 38 papers from the research track which were accepted from
170 submissions; Part II: Includes 22 papers from the resources
track which were accepted from 71 submissions; and 21 papers in the
in-use track, which had a total of 46 submissions.

Chinese war epic directed by Ronny Yu. During the Song Dynasty in
986 AD, the Khitan army attacks and abducts General Yang (Adam
Cheng), leaving his wife and seven sons to fend for themselves. But
not being a group to settle under terrible circumstances, the seven
sons, led by the eldest sibling Yang Yan Ping (Ekin Cheng), embark
on a journey to the Wolf Mountain to face their father's captors
and end the feud once and for all...
